An Analytical Overview of Women’s Golf Putters

The golf equipment industry has seen a significant evolution in the design and availability of putters specifically tailored for female golfers. Historically, women’s putters were often simply lighter versions of men’s models. However, modern trends indicate a move towards more sophisticated engineering, recognizing the distinct biomechanical needs of many women. Key design features now commonly include shorter lengths, lighter overall weights, and slightly increased loft to accommodate a higher hand position at address and a potentially less aggressive putting stroke. Manufacturers are also focusing on improved grip designs, often thinner and more contoured, to better fit smaller hands, enhancing feel and control.

The benefits of using a putter designed for women are substantial. These specialized clubs are engineered to optimize a golfer’s natural swing tempo and arc, leading to more consistent ball striking and improved distance control. The reduced weight can also help prevent fatigue during a round, allowing for a more sustained level of performance. Furthermore, the aesthetic appeal of putters now caters more directly to women’s preferences, with a wider range of color options and finishes available, contributing to a more enjoyable and confidence-inspiring golfing experience. This focus on user experience is crucial in encouraging more women to engage with and improve their game.

Despite these advancements, challenges remain in the market for women’s putters. The perception that specialized equipment is a luxury rather than a necessity can deter some golfers from investing in a putter designed for their specific needs. Additionally, while the variety of options is growing, the breadth of highly technical, premium offerings may still lag behind those available for men. Ensuring that accurate fitting advice is readily accessible is also a challenge, as an ill-fitting putter, regardless of gender specification, can hinder performance. The ongoing quest to identify the best womens putters requires continued education and access to expert fitting.

Looking ahead, the trajectory for women’s putter design is promising. As more data is collected on women’s golf mechanics and preferences, manufacturers are likely to continue innovating with materials, weighting systems, and adjustability features. The increasing participation of women in golf globally will undoubtedly drive further specialization and a broader selection of high-performance options. This will empower female golfers to make informed choices, ultimately leading to greater enjoyment and success on the greens.

Choosing the Right Putter Style for Your Game

The choice between a blade putter and a mallet putter is a fundamental decision that significantly impacts your putting stroke and overall performance. Blade putters, with their classic, slender profile, are generally favored by golfers with a straighter back-and-forth putting stroke. Their design often offers more feedback to the hands, allowing for precise distance control and a keen sense of the green’s contours. For players who prefer a more traditional feel and a direct connection to the ball, a blade putter can be an excellent choice. However, they typically have less forgiveness on off-center strikes, meaning mishits will deviate more from your intended line.

Conversely, mallet putters, characterized by their larger, often more geometric heads, are designed to offer enhanced forgiveness and stability. Their larger surface area and distributed weight help to minimize the impact of off-center hits, keeping the ball closer to its intended path. This makes them ideal for golfers who exhibit a more arcing putting stroke, often referred to as a “toe-hang” or “face-balanced” stroke, as the design inherently promotes a more stable, pendulum-like motion. Mallets also come with a variety of alignment aids, from simple lines to more complex geometric shapes, which can be invaluable for golfers struggling with consistent aim.

When considering putter style, it’s crucial to understand your natural putting motion. A simple test involves holding the putter loosely in front of you and letting it swing naturally. If it hangs relatively flat or with minimal toe-upward angle, you likely have a more straight-back-straight-through stroke, pointing towards a blade. If the toe points significantly upwards, suggesting a toe-hang, a mallet putter with a suitable toe-hang design will often complement this motion more effectively. Experimenting with both styles on the putting green, paying close attention to feel, stability, and ball roll, is the most reliable way to determine which style best suits your individual needs.

Beyond the basic blade vs. mallet dichotomy, there are further nuances to consider. Face-balanced putters are designed to remain square to the target through the stroke, ideal for those with a straight-back-straight-through motion, while toe-hang putters are designed to naturally rotate closed during the downswing, suiting those with an arcing stroke. Understanding these subtle differences and how they interact with your personal swing mechanics is paramount to selecting a putter that will consistently deliver reliable results on the greens.

Assessing Putter Weight and Balance for Optimal Control

The weight and balance of a putter are critical components that influence feel, stability, and the tempo of your putting stroke. A putter that feels too light can lead to a jerky or inconsistent stroke, while one that is too heavy can feel cumbersome and difficult to control. The overall weight of the putter head, combined with the weight and flexibility of the shaft, contributes to the total weight. Modern putters offer a range of head weights, allowing golfers to customize their feel. Heavier heads generally promote a smoother, more pendulum-like stroke, particularly beneficial for maintaining consistent tempo.

Putter balance, often expressed as “swing weight” or “moment of inertia,” refers to how the weight is distributed. This is where the concepts of face-balanced and toe-hang become particularly relevant. A face-balanced putter, as mentioned, remains square through the stroke, ideal for a straight-back-straight-through motion. A putter with toe-hang will naturally rotate closed as it swings, aligning with an arcing stroke. Understanding whether you have a dominant arc in your stroke or a more linear motion is key to selecting a putter with the appropriate balance.

When evaluating putters, pay close attention to how the weight feels in your hands and how it encourages a smooth, repeatable motion. Some golfers prefer a heavier feel for greater stability and a more consistent tempo, especially on longer putts. Others might find a lighter putter allows for more finesse and touch on shorter, more delicate strokes. The grip itself also plays a role; larger, heavier grips can contribute to a more stable feel and encourage the use of the shoulders rather than the wrists, which is often beneficial for consistent results.

Ultimately, the ideal putter weight and balance are subjective and depend on individual preference and biomechanics. It is highly recommended to test various putters with different weight distributions and head balances. Focus on how the putter feels during your natural putting stroke, how well you can control the face through impact, and whether it helps you maintain a consistent tempo. A well-balanced putter that complements your stroke will undoubtedly lead to increased confidence and improved performance on the greens.

The Significance of Putter Length and Grip Fit

The length of a putter is not merely an aesthetic consideration; it directly influences your posture, eye position relative to the ball, and the overall arc of your putting stroke. A putter that is too long will force you to stand too upright, potentially leading to an inconsistent setup and a stroke that relies too heavily on the hands. Conversely, a putter that is too short will require you to crouch too much, which can lead to tension and a restricted swing. The correct putter length allows you to address the ball with your eyes directly over or slightly inside the target line, promoting a more natural and repeatable setup.

The grip is the sole point of contact between the golfer and the putter, making its fit and feel paramount for consistent control. Putter grips come in a wide array of shapes, sizes, and textures. Some golfers prefer a thinner grip for a more traditional feel and the ability to manipulate the clubface with their hands. Others find that larger, more oversized grips promote a more relaxed grip pressure, encouraging the use of the larger muscles of the arms and shoulders, which can lead to a more stable and consistent putting stroke.

Finding the right grip size is essential for optimal performance. A grip that is too thin can lead to excessive wrist action, while one that is too thick can restrict feel and putter head manipulation. Many golfers find that a grip that fits comfortably in their hands without feeling cramped or overly tight provides the best control. Some grips also feature specific textures or materials to enhance tackiness and moisture management, further contributing to a secure and consistent hold during the stroke.

It’s crucial to understand that putter length and grip fit are interconnected. Changing the length of a putter can necessitate adjustments to the grip, and vice versa. Professional club fitters can accurately measure your ideal putter length and recommend the most suitable grip type and size based on your hand size and putting stroke mechanics. Prioritizing these seemingly minor details can have a significant positive impact on your consistency and confidence on the greens, leading to a more enjoyable and successful golfing experience.

Exploring Putter Materials and Construction Technologies

The materials and construction technologies employed in putter manufacturing have evolved dramatically, offering golfers a wider range of options to enhance feel, performance, and aesthetics. Traditional putters were often milled from a single block of high-quality steel, such as 303 or 1025 carbon steel. This milling process allows for precise shaping and can impart a soft, buttery feel to the clubface, providing excellent feedback to the hands. The density of steel also contributes to a solid sound at impact, which many golfers find desirable.

More advanced putters often incorporate multiple materials to optimize performance. For instance, many mallet putters feature a combination of a stainless steel or aluminum body with a heavier tungsten or steel sole weighting. This strategic placement of weight lowers the center of gravity, promoting a higher launch angle and a more consistent roll. Furthermore, some designs utilize polymer or elastomer inserts within the clubface to dampen vibration, create a softer feel, and enhance the trampoline effect for improved distance control, particularly on off-center hits.

The face insert technology is another area of significant innovation. Some inserts are made of materials like urethane or specialized composites, designed to provide a softer feel and a more consistent ball speed across the entire face. Others feature grooves or milling patterns specifically engineered to reduce skidding and promote a cleaner roll immediately after impact. These advancements aim to improve the predictability of your putts, reducing the likelihood of the ball bouncing or skidding, which can negatively affect its path towards the hole.

When selecting a putter, consider how the materials and construction will influence the feel, sound, and performance characteristics. If you prioritize a crisp, traditional feel and direct feedback, a milled steel putter might be ideal. If you seek enhanced forgiveness, stability, and a softer impact, putters with multi-material construction and advanced face inserts could be more beneficial. Understanding these technological nuances will empower you to make a more informed decision that aligns with your personal preferences and contributes to a more effective putting game.

Frequently Asked Questions

What are the key differences between men’s and women’s putters?

The primary distinctions between men’s and women’s putters lie in their physical specifications, designed to cater to average biomechanical differences. Women’s putters typically feature shorter shaft lengths, generally ranging from 32 to 35 inches, compared to men’s putters which often start at 34 inches and can extend to 36 inches or more. This shorter shaft is intended to accommodate a typically lower average height and a more upright posture at address for female golfers, promoting a more natural and comfortable swing.

Furthermore, women’s putters often come with lighter overall weight and reduced swing weight. This lighter feel can make the putter easier to control and swing smoothly, especially for golfers with less upper body strength or those seeking a more forgiving stroke. Grip size also plays a role, with women’s putters often featuring slightly slimmer grips, which can be more comfortable and manageable for smaller hands. While these are generalizations, individual preference and body type should always be the guiding factor when choosing a putter.

How does putter length affect my putting stroke?

The length of your putter is a critical factor that significantly influences your posture, eye alignment, and the arc of your swing. A putter that is too long will force you to stoop excessively, potentially leading to an inconsistent stroke, poor weight distribution, and difficulty maintaining a stable lower body. This can result in a tendency to “hang back” on the downswing, causing scooping or lifting the putter face, which are common causes of inconsistent distance control and direction.

Conversely, a putter that is too short can cause you to stand too close to the ball, leading to an overly upright stance and potential tension in your arms and shoulders. This can restrict the natural pendulum motion of the putting stroke, making it harder to generate consistent tempo and power. The ideal putter length allows you to adopt a relaxed and athletic posture with your eyes comfortably over the ball, enabling a smooth, repeatable stroke with your shoulders acting as the primary pendulum. Many fitting studies suggest that golfers who use correctly fitted putter lengths see improvements in both consistency and confidence.

What is MOI, and why should women golfers consider it when choosing a putter?

MOI, or Moment of Inertia, is a physics principle that measures an object’s resistance to rotation. In the context of putters, a higher MOI signifies that the putter head is more stable and resistant to twisting when struck off-center. This stability is achieved through strategic weighting, often by distributing mass towards the heel and toe of the putter head, a characteristic typically found in larger mallet designs. For women golfers, particularly those who may not consistently strike the ball on the sweet spot, a higher MOI putter can be highly advantageous.

A putter with a high MOI will help to keep the face more square to the target line through impact, even if the contact isn’t perfect. This means that off-center hits will result in less deviation in both direction and distance compared to a putter with a lower MOI. This added forgiveness can lead to more consistent ball speeds and straighter putts, ultimately reducing the number of three-putts and improving scoring. While aesthetics and personal preference are important, understanding the role of MOI can significantly enhance a woman golfer’s putting performance by promoting greater consistency.
